[PATCH] PCI: fix level for vendor data capability
On Thu, Oct 07 2021, Cornelia Huck <[email protected]> wrote:
> The normative statements for the vendor data capability need
> to be at paragraph level insted of subsection level.
>
> Signed-off-by: Cornelia Huck <[email protected]>
> ---
> I plan to push this as an editorial update.
Now pushed.
